大数据研发的核心,如何构建坚实的基础数据平台?

大数据基础研发涉及收集、存储、管理和分析庞大的数据集,目的是从这些数据中提取有价值的信息和见解。基础数据是这一过程的起点,包括原始数据收集和初步处理,确保数据质量和可用性,为后续的高级分析和决策提供支持。

在当今时代,数据已经成为了新的资源,大数据作为这一资源的体现,不仅挑战着传统的数据处理方式,也带来了前所未有的机遇,本文旨在全面介绍大数据基础研发的相关知识,包括大数据的定义、类型、处理技术及其在多个领域中的应用。

大数据基础研发_基础数据
(图片来源网络,侵删)

大数据基础知识定义

大数据是指在传统数据处理应用软件难以处理的大量、高增长率和多样化的信息资产,这些数据集合因其庞大的体积、快速的数据流转、多样的数据类型以及较低的价值密度而显著不同,大数据的四大特征——大容量、快速、多样、真实,要求采用新的处理模式以提升决策、洞察发现和流程优化的能力。

大数据的类型与特征

大数据可以按照其结构化程度分为三类:结构化数据(如数据库中的表格数据)、半结构化数据(如XML文件)、非结构化数据(如文本、图片、视频等),每种类型的数据都有其特定的存储和处理需求,对技术的适应性和灵活性提出了更高的要求。

大数据处理技术

大数据处理涉及的技术广泛,从数据采集、存储到分析展示,每一步都需要专业的技术支持。

1、数据采集:涉及日志收集、网络爬虫等手段获取数据。

大数据基础研发_基础数据
(图片来源网络,侵删)

2、数据存储:使用数据仓库、NoSQL数据库、分布式文件系统等存储解决方案。

3、数据处理:运用MapReduce、Spark等大规模数据并行处理框架。

4、数据分析:通过统计分析、机器学习、深度学习等方法提取数据价值。

5、结果展现:利用数据可视化工具将分析结果以图表或报告的形式呈现。

大数据应用领域

大数据的应用遍及社会生活的各个领域,包括但不限于:

医疗健康:通过分析患者历史数据,实现个性化医疗服务和疾病预测。

大数据基础研发_基础数据
(图片来源网络,侵删)

公共服务:利用大数据优化交通管理,提高公共安全。

电子商务:通过用户行为分析,推荐个性化商品,提高用户体验。

制造业:通过机器数据分析,优化生产流程和设备维护。

农业:利用气候、土壤等数据指导农业生产,提高作物产量。

大数据技术详解

在构建大数据平台时,需要涉及以下关键技术组件:

1、基础架构:Hadoop是一个开源框架,支持数据密集型分布式应用,处理大规模数据集。

2、存储系统:包括HDFS(Hadoop Distributed File System),提供高吞吐量的数据访问。

3、数据库:NoSQL数据库如MongoDB、Cassandra提供非关系型数据的存储与查询。

4、数据仓库:为企业决策提供数据支持,如Amazon Redshift。

5、资源调度:YARN(Yet Another Resource Negotiator)负责集群资源管理和调度。

6、查询引擎:如Apache Hive,提供数据仓库的查询功能。

7、实时框架:Apache Storm、Apache Flink支持实时数据处理。

学习路径方面,大数据工程师需掌握上述技术外,还应了解编程语言(如Java、Python)、数据分析算法、计算框架及数据可视化等知识。

相关问答FAQs

1. 什么是大数据?

大数据指的是无法用传统数据库工具在合理时间内进行捕捉、管理和处理的庞大、高速、多样化的数据集合,它要求采用新的处理模式以提升信息的价值提取效率。

2. 大数据的处理流程是怎样的?

大数据的处理流程主要包括数据采集、数据存储、数据处理、数据分析和结果展现五个阶段,每个阶段都依赖于不同的技术和方法来完成,最终目的是从海量数据中提取有价值的信息,为决策提供支持。

通过以上内容的介绍,我们了解了大数据的基本概念、类型、处理技术以及在不同领域的应用情况,随着技术的不断进步,大数据将继续在各行各业发挥越来越重要的作用,为人类社会的发展带来新的动力。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/881664.html

(0)
未希的头像未希新媒体运营
上一篇 2024-08-16 02:11
下一篇 2024-08-16 02:13

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入